The cheapest way to get from Gwangmyeong Station to Express Bus Terminal Station is to drive which costs ₩4,000 - ₩6,000 and takes 18 min.
The fastest way to get from Gwangmyeong Station to Express Bus Terminal Station is to taxi which takes 18 min and costs ₩21,000 - ₩26,000.
No, there is no direct train from Gwangmyeong Station station to Express Bus Terminal Station station. However, there are services departing from Gwangmyeong Station and arriving at Express Bus Terminal Station via Seoul Station and Dongjak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 43 min.
The distance between Gwangmyeong Station and Express Bus Terminal Station is 32 km. The road distance is 18.4 km.
The best way to get from Gwangmyeong Station to Express Bus Terminal Station without a car is to train and subway which takes 43 min and costs ₩5,500 - ₩10,000.
It takes approximately 43 min to get from Gwangmyeong Station to Express Bus Terminal Station, including transfers.

What companies run services between Gwangmyeong Station, South Korea and Express Bus Terminal Station, South Korea?
Gyeonggi Traffic Information Center operates a bus from Gwangmyeong KTX Station Exit 5 to Sadang Station Exit 4 every 15 minutes. Tickets cost ₩2,100–3,000 and the journey takes 40 min.
